About This Item

Indianapolis Indiana: United Christian Missionary Society. Good. 1948. Soft. 71 clean pages. DJ has very little wear and is wrapped in mylar cover. An excellent copy of this hard to find book. Ex (church) library with stamps and pocket. Otherwise very clean and tight for older paperback. 127 pages. Missionary work in Africa. .

Glossary

Some terminology that may be used in this description includes:

Tight
Used to mean that the binding of a book has not been overly loosened by frequent use.
